A brief tornado touched down in central Knox County Thursday afternoon.
Officials say the weak, spin-up tornado tracked over and northeast of State Road 550, following Mariah Creek toward Bruceville.
Most of the damage was limited to trees in a heavily wooded area.
Some county roads west of Bruceville were also affected.
The tornado was part of a larger storm system that moved through the area.
That storm also caused power outages around Vincennes.
Indiana State Police reported that a tornado moved through the Winslow area, resulting in downed trees and power lines, particularly on side streets.
Several homes and structures sustained damage.
No injuries have been reported at this time.
The public is asked to avoid affected areas, use caution while traveling, and never approach downed power lines.
